2 1/2 ton floor jack Costco
Made in China and the maximum lift height is 18.5" Is that enough for our SAV's? Harbor freight is not too far from me so if this ain't good enough might stop by HF but I don't doubt it those are made in China as well.Should I look for some American made stuff?i need a good jack to last me for years to come. Let me know what you guys think.

I look more closely at the lift height than the tonnage; 18.5" is probably ok for an e53, but higher is better. I bought a floor jack at Sears several years ago with a 22.5" lift. I'm a big guy and appreciate the extra few inches.
